Can I request a copy of a family member's criminal record in the Dominican Republic if I have written authorization from that person?

Yes, if you have written authorization from a family member, you can request a copy of their criminal record in the Dominican Republic on their behalf. It is important that the authorization is correctly written and signed by the person whose background you wish to verify.

Can I obtain a Costa Rican identity card if I am a minor and my parents are foreigners residing in Costa Rica?

Yes, as a minor with foreign parents residing in Costa Rica, you can obtain a Costa Rican identity card. You must meet the requirements established by the Civil Registry and present the required documentation, which may include your parents' immigration documents and other additional documents.

What are the rights of women in Argentina in relation to marriage and divorce?

In Argentina, women have the right to marry and divorce on equal terms with men. The law recognizes equal rights and responsibilities between spouses, as well as the right to dissolve the marriage at the will of either party. Measures have been implemented to protect women's rights in divorce cases, such as equitable distribution of assets and protection of child custody and visitation rights.
